62042 Coloplast Защитная пленка "ПРЕП" в салфетках (1шт)

После обработки кожи вокруг стомы салфетками Conveen (Конвин) Преп на ней создается защитная пленка. Пленка является барьером между кожей и выделениям из стомы. Таким образом, она препятствует контакту мочи или кала с кожей, предотвращая раздражения, покраснения, контактный дерматит и др. В то же время пленка не препятствует воздухообмену, позволяет коже "дышать", что способствует заживлению поврежденной кожи. Пленка также защищает кожу от адгезивных травм, которые возникает вследствие смены кало - или мочеприемников. Удобная форма выпуска - салфетки, позволяет брать их с собой в дорогу, в путешествие или просто носить в сумочке и использовать при необходимости.

Инструкция:

1. Обработайте необходимый участок кожи салфеткой (салфетку не оставлять). Кожа предварительно должна быть очищена и высушена.

2. Дайте жидкости высохнуть. На покрасневших участках кожи возможно легкое покалывание. Нанесенная на кожу пленка не растворяется в воде и обеспечивает защиту даже при купании.

 

3. Под действие кожных липидов, через некоторое время, пленка удаляется сама, при необходимости можно смыть очистителем.
